> On Tue, 11 Apr 2000 at 17:52:20 -0700, Matt M. wrote:
> > Just wondering why the port doesn't create/install gtk-config, which
> > is required if you are developing your own gtk-based apps.
> 
> It installs gtk12-config, because it makes it easier to co-exist with
> other versions of gtk (gtk11, gtk10, etc.), which are still in the ports
> collection.  Why can't you 'ln -fs gtk12-config gtk-config' if you need
> it to be gtk-config?
